Conditions

Lateral Malleolus Fractures. Fracture of lateral malleolus

Interventions

Intervention group: WALANT technique group and SPINAL technique was used in the second group. The way to prepare the solution for the Walant technique is based on previous studies and taking into acco

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: With Lateral Malleolus fracture

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Cardiovascular problems, Open fracture, Psychiatric problems, Old fracture and non-union, fracture with Vascular Nerve damage

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Variables including bleeding volume, surgery time, wound complications, pain intensity were evaluated between Walant and spinal techniques. Timepoint: The variables were examined during surgery and 1, 7 and 30. Method of measurement: Questionnaire, clinical view.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Quick recovery and discharge from the hospital. Timepoint: After discharge from the operating room. Method of measurement: Record the time of discharge in the file.
